## Service accounts — PerkLedger

For the sync: reminder that all reads of the loyalty-points ledger now go through the perk-reader service account, not personal creds. Batch adjustments still need the writer account, which ops rotates monthly. If you're testing locally before Thursday's demo, the current staging key is below.

app token of tagef-tafog = qvz3-7n0

Subject: Handover — Chirpline deploy-status bot

Handing Chirpline over for the week. It posts deploy states to the #releases channel every five minutes; if it goes quiet, restart the poller on the ops box. Pipeline config is in the runbook, section three. To redeploy the bot itself, sign the container manifest with the key that follows.

release key, kawif-hawep: bky13_X7TGuRG4Zu4ZJ

**Checklist item: Admin dashboard dark mode**

Before cutting the Glintboard release: verify dark-mode toggle persists across sessions, check contrast on all chart widgets, confirm no hardcoded hex values remain in the settings pane. New folks: use the theming lint rule, don't eyeball it. Sign off in the tracker once done. Validate against the candidate build noted below.

pipeline stamp: htk31_f769b577b3028a4e9958e5bb8d1259a

**Ceremony Checklist — Item 4: API Pagination Tokens**

After rotating the Bramblehook signing key, regenerate the pagination cursor secret for the public REST API. Old cursors must expire within 24h; clients re-fetch page one automatically. Verify `next` links resolve on staging before sign-off. The cursor secret vault unseals with the passphrase below.

vault phrase of bagaf-kajeg = jorath-feniel-briir-siliel-ralix